What is the best dress color for pale skin?

If your pale skin has warm undertones, opt for dresses in earthy tones like tan, beige, brown, and green. Neutrals also work, including colors like navy and gray. If your pale skin has cool undertones, wear silver or pastel hues of your favorite color.

Why being pale is beautiful?

Paleness was seen as a marker of beauty but also, for some, as an indication of character. Aristotle’s Physiognomy relates that “a vivid complexion shows heat and warm blood, but a pink-and-white complexion proves a good disposition.” More than character, however, pale skin was a marker of social status and class.

Does pale skin make you look younger?

Considering the detrimental effects that the sun can have on our skin, it shouldn’t come as too much of a surprise that lighter skin tones typically ages faster than darker ones. “More photoaging occurs in pale skin, as there is less protection from UV damage,” explains Dr. Alexa B.

Does grey look good on pale skin?

Deeper greys flatter lighter skin tones.
If you have pale skin, choose a medium shade of grey, which will stand out better against a lighter canvas. Steer clear of lighter shades of grey, such as ash, because these will wash you out and make you look even paler.

How do you tell if a colour suits you?

There are a couple of ways to figure out which team you’re on. Look at the Veins in Your Wrist. If your skin is light enough that you can see your veins, look at whether they appear blue or green under your skin. The former indicates that you have a cool skin tone while the latter says you have a warm one.
